Amazon is Hiring Nearly 3,000 Professionals Across India

Amazon, the global e-commerce giant, is doubling down on its commitment to India. The company is hiring for locations across India including Gurugram, West Bengal, Bengaluru, Delhi, Mumbai and so on.

With a focus on innovation, customer experience, and regional growth, Amazon is set to hire nearly 3,000 professionals across various domains.

Diverse Roles at Amazon: From Tech to Customer Service

Amazon’s hiring drive spans various roles, catering to diverse skill sets and interests.

How to Apply: If you are interested in the recent job openings at Amazon you can apply through the company’s official Career Page, LinkedIn Page or through other Job Portals.

Senior Business Development Manager (Tech): The XCM (Cross Channel, Cross Category Marketing) India team at Amazon India seeks a talented Senior Business Development Manager. This role involves leading Content Publishers Growth, driving innovation, and shaping marketing strategies.

Senior Technical Program Manager (Events): Amazon runs highly successful events, including Diwali sales and Prime Day. The Senior TPM for Events will play a pivotal role in creating compelling promotions during these large-scale events.

Software Development Engineer (Amazon Credit & Lending): This role involves designing and building a new Fintech Payments product from scratch. Imagine enabling hundreds of millions of Amazon customers to shop seamlessly using cutting-edge payment solutions.

Senior Program Manager (Heavy & Bulky Dex): If you’re customer-obsessed, analytical, and passionate about e-commerce, this role might be for you. The Heavy & Bulky Dex team focuses on efficient delivery of large items, ensuring customer satisfaction.

Rethinking E-Commerce: An India-First Perspective

Trusted E-Commerce Platform: Amazon’s mission in India is clear—to change the way buyers and sellers interact online. The company aims to build a trusted e-commerce platform that caters specifically to the Indian market.

Customer-Centric Approach: Working backward from the customer has been Amazon’s secret sauce. Since its launch in India, the product selection has expanded to an impressive 100 million items. The goal? To become a convenient online shopping destination for every Indian.

Long-Term Investment: Amazon is committed to long-term investment in India, raising the bar for customer experience. This commitment extends to its workforce.
